EN 19CONTROLS AND INSTRUMENTS
Afterwards, when a warning light comes on,
it indicates:
b) seat without operator;
c) blades engaged;
d) parking brake engaged;
e) missing grass-catcher or stone-
guard;
f) insufficient battery recharge; look
for the causes in chapter 7 of this
manual;
g) transmission in “neutral” position.
h) low fuel: it means that approx. 1.5
liters are left in the tank, which is
enough for 30-40 minutes of nor-
mal work;
j) problems with the engine’s lubrica-
tion: turn the engine off immediate-
ly and check the oil level (5.3.3).
If the problem persists, contact your
Dealer.
k) This warning light comes on when the key (4.4) is in the «ON» position
and always stays on while operating.
– If it blinks, it means that the engine cannot be started (5.2).
l) The sensor located inside the dashboard turns on the headlights automatically
(in models where included) after approximately few of darkness and turns
them off after few seconds of light.
To avoid unnecessary use of them, keep the area near the sensor clean
and do not place rags or objects on the dashboard.
m) There are two types of sound warnings:
continuous the electronic card’s protection device has cut in;
intermittent warning that the grass-catcher is full.
